I loved this hotel. I stayed here 3 nights for business this week. I highly recommend it and I…read morecan't wait to return. There is a great restaurant onsite too. A babbling, fast moving river out front. It's a classic European hotel. They don't even ask for a credit card when checking in! Very affordable too. Words of advice. Reserve online through their website, not a booking site. It's less expensive and is better for them. Email or call them for follow-up prior to arriving. If you don't speak French, it's best to write them first. If you want dinner in the hotel (I highly recommend), reserve it ahead of time, or you will be out of luck. I recommend their breakfast onsite too. They have a great choice and the coffee is excellent. If you haven't been here before, I recommend arriving in the daylight. The grounds are beautiful and worth seeing in the daylight, but the roads approaching it can be a bit difficult in the dark. I can't wait to return here soon!

After a day of sightseeing in foggy January weather in the Ardennes it was such a pleasure to…read morearrive at this hotel. Christmas had been over for about two weeks but the xmas lights were still up in Bouillon and in the hotel the four or five Christmas trees and assorted decorations perfectly complimented the old school marble and wood decor of the hotel giving it the feel of having stepped back in time to a slightly more elegant age. Check in was a breez and the staff were delightful And helpful. While I got on with that my wife and the rest of our party relaxed in the bar/ bistro which again with its log fire, sensitive lighting, long banquets and decorations made us all feel relaxed and at home. All in all the only thing that let this hotel down were the rooms and overall condition of the upper floors. Although our rooms had bee redecorated recently the attention to detail just wasn't there. Very creaky floorboards and a bathroom light switch that also turned on a ceiling light over the bed were just some of the things that made the stay a bit challenging but the bed was very comfortable. We had dinner in the restaurant which at night when lit with a vast array of candles and overlooking the river was magical. The food was fair and the wine was excellent and priced accordingly Overall the five of us had a great time and over a very well stocked breakfast buffet recounted the highlights of our trip and it was hard at the time to find much fault with our stay but looking back there are reasons that I'm not going to give five stars but they should not deter you from trying this hotel and maybe you will also experience some of those things that made it a truly magical weekend.
